Maina bird meaning in tamil

மைனா மயினா பூவை lady, woman, tree Online English to Tamil Dictionary : orb or disk of the moon - சந்திரமண்டலம் watchers raised shed or platform in fields - படகம் as far - dv. மட்டும் age of child bearing - காய்க்கும்பருவம் artful rogue - மழுமாறி

